Jonas Russian Blair

Birth30 May 1874 - Coles, Illinois, United States
Death30 July 1964 - Charleston, Coles County, Illinois, United States of America
MotherMary Ann Kite
FatherRussian Ruben Blair

Born in Coles, Illinois, United States on 30 May 1874 to Russian Ruben Blair and Mary Ann Kite. Jonas Russian Blair married Myrtle MAXWELL and had 5 children. He passed away on 30 July 1964 in Charleston, Coles County, Illinois, United States of America.
